/*
* Exception priority: lower has higher precedence.
*
+ * Cortex-M3
+ * =====================================
+ * Prio 0x30: svc
+ * ---------------------
+ * Prio 0x40: thread temporarily inhibiting schedule for critical region
+ * ...
+ * Prio 0xb0: systick, external interrupt
+ * Prio 0xc0: pendsv
+ * =====================================
+ *
+ * Cortex-M0
+ * =====================================
* Prio 0x00: thread temporarily inhibiting schedule for critical region
* ...
* Prio 0x40: systick, external interrupt
* Prio 0x80: pendsv
* Prio 0x80: svc
+ * =====================================
*/
+#define CPU_EXCEPTION_PRIORITY_CLEAR 0
+
+#if defined(__ARM_ARCH_6M__)
#define CPU_EXCEPTION_PRIORITY_INHIBIT_SCHED 0x00
/* ... */
#define CPU_EXCEPTION_PRIORITY_SYSTICK CPU_EXCEPTION_PRIORITY_INTERRUPT
#define CPU_EXCEPTION_PRIORITY_INTERRUPT 0x40
#define CPU_EXCEPTION_PRIORITY_PENDSV 0x80
-#define CPU_EXCEPTION_PRIORITY_SVC 0x80
+#define CPU_EXCEPTION_PRIORITY_SVC 0x80 /* No use in this arch */
+#elif defined(__ARM_ARCH_7M__)
+#define CPU_EXCEPTION_PRIORITY_SVC 0x30
+
+#define CPU_EXCEPTION_PRIORITY_INHIBIT_SCHED 0x40
+/* ... */
+#define CPU_EXCEPTION_PRIORITY_SYSTICK CPU_EXCEPTION_PRIORITY_INTERRUPT
+#define CPU_EXCEPTION_PRIORITY_INTERRUPT 0xb0
+#define CPU_EXCEPTION_PRIORITY_PENDSV 0xc0
+#else
+#error "no support for this arch"
+#endif
